Hot Water Demographics - Gooburrum
Based on the Australian Bureau of Statistics 2021 Census (ABS), Gooburrum has around 35,764 private dwellings, home to approximately 78,116 people. With an average household size of 2.4 people, and around 50 litres of hot water used per person each day in Australia, Gooburrum households use approximately 120 litres of hot water daily, equating to a massive 4.3 million litres of hot water used across the suburb every single day.

Hot Water Rebates, Tariffs & Savings
In Gooburrum, interest in replacing old gas or resistive electric units with efficient options is growing fast. Federal incentives such as Small‑scale Technology Certificates (STCs) apply to eligible solar hot water systems and heat pump units, effectively lowering the upfront hot water system cost or heat pump hot water cost at the point of sale. On top of that, Queensland hot water rebate programs and other state‑based schemes can offer a solar hot water rebate, heat pump hot water rebate or electric hot water system rebate for approved upgrades. For many Gooburrum households, these discounts can reduce the system cost by a substantial percentage and cut the payback period to just a few years, especially when combined with rooftop solar and smart timers or solar‑diversion controls.
